Indie producer Julia Stemock took her professional frustrations and disappointments and made lemonade, in the form of a newly released DVD/CD ROM package entitled “The Basics of Filmmaking.”

“The Basics of Filmmaking” focuses the cameras on working professionals who cover every step of the filmmaking process, each addressing his or her particular area of expertise. Subjects include accounting, acquisitions, actors, directing, composing and original music, editing, distribution and producer’s representatives, festivals and screenings, financing, insurance and completion bonds, legal aspects and copyrights, locations, marketing, music editing and music licensing. Also discussed are negative cutting, post sound, producing, production design and art departments, pre-production and production guidelines, publicity and press packages, schools, titles and digital design, writing and scripts, and more.

The CD ROM included in the package contains a wealth of valuable resources, forms and checklists. Included are lists and website locations for guilds, festivals, trade shows, and industry publications; distributor’s delivery requirements; a production chart; feature film and video production budget examples; and, a glossary of terms. Checklists are included for distribution, editorial and sound, finance, insurance, legal, literary acquisition, location, producer, publicity and talent. Agreement forms include co-production, joint venture, location, non-disclosure and writer collaboration examples.
